Making a complaint

Mesothelioma suits provide compensation to asbestos victims, their families, and the community for the financial, emotional and physical damages caused by this fatal disease. Lawsuits can also hold responsible companies accountable for their actions and influence how they conduct business in the future.

A mesothelioma lawyer with experience will assist you to determine where to file, determine potential defendants, and fill out the necessary paperwork. State laws, referred to as statutes or limitations, determine the time limit for filing a lawsuit. The time frame usually begins with the date you were diagnosed for personal injury claims, and the date of death of a loved one in claims involving wrongful death.

After completing the required paperwork, attorneys for mesothelioma begin the process of gathering information and distributing it to all manufacturers named in a lawsuit. lawsuit mesothelioma for both sides then negotiate an amount of settlement with each defendant. It usually takes eighteen months or more to reach a final agreement. Settlements are influenced by a variety of factors such as the number and level of responsibility of defendants, the availability and coverage of insurance, and the amount of funds available.

The majority of mesothelioma lawyers prefer to settle outside of court. This decreases the time it takes to receive compensation and limits the likelihood that a trial will be required. If a trial becomes necessary, compensation may take much longer and cost more.

In addition to paying mesothelioma patients compensation for their medical expenses and lost wages, a settlement must include pain and suffering. A nationally renowned mesothelioma attorney firm can assist you in obtaining compensation for these losses.

Asbestos patients may file a mesothelioma suit against various asbestos trust funds or manufacturers at the same time as part of a class action lawsuit. However, several states have refused to accept these types of lawsuits and ruled that the varying exposure histories and diseases of each victim make it difficult to recognize a class. Because of this, most mesothelioma lawsuits are filed as individual cases or mass torts rather than class action lawsuits. The process of negotiating a settlement

Asbestos sufferers require an attorney who can assist them in filing claims as well as conduct investigations and negotiate with settlement companies.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ist in the case of a trial and ensure that the victim receives compensation.

Gathering as much information as possible regarding your case is the first step towards filing a mesothelioma lawsuit. This could take several months, or perhaps longer depending on the circumstances. When the lawyer has enough information, they will then file the lawsuit. Each defendant is given an official copy of the lawsuit and is given a specific time to respond, typically 30 days. They may defend the claim or claim that somebody else is responsible.

During the discovery phase, both parties will ask for information to strengthen their arguments. This could include written or in-person depositions, which a victim or their family members may have to go through. Mesothelioma attorneys can help victims prepare for these depositions, which typically last for a whole day or more.

After looking over all evidence, defendants will begin negotiations with your mesothelioma suit attorneys. They will attempt to settle your case, which is preferable to going to trial. If they are unable to agree on an equitable settlement, the case will need to go to trial.

Many mesothelioma lawsuits are settled through settlements, and this is due to the time-consuming and risky procedure of bringing the case to the court. Great mesothelioma lawyers will be able to deal with defendants in order to convince them to provide the most amount of compensation.

Mesothelioma settlements can cover a variety of damages, including past and future lost wages, reduced earning capacity as well as funeral costs, as well as pain and suffering. Many asbestos lawsuits have included the claim of wrongful death that could double or even triple the amount of compensation awarded.
